aboutsummaryrefslogtreecommitdiff
path: root/internal/postgres/unit.go
diff options
context:
space:
mode:
authorJulie Qiu <julie@golang.org>2020-09-01 18:52:12 -0400
committerJulie Qiu <julie@golang.org>2020-09-02 16:45:25 +0000
commit16ca4f2299153124ca2f996b94db92bc98fcebd1 (patch)
tree798a3073849cb63b6ac5391b7900a4a1b6dd57df /internal/postgres/unit.go
parentafffc195e7586c235e41479ad391babe4f2edb05 (diff)
downloadgo-x-pkgsite-16ca4f2299153124ca2f996b94db92bc98fcebd1.tar.xz
internal: move Unit.Package.Documentation to Unit.Documentation
The Documentation field is moved from Unit.Package.Documentation to Unit.Documentation. Unit.Package will be deprecated in a later CL. For golang/go#39629 Change-Id: Idc6d6598a2647a55b55c947120c322fec5da59cc Reviewed-on: https://go-review.googlesource.com/c/pkgsite/+/252321 Reviewed-by: Jonathan Amsterdam <jba@google.com>
Diffstat (limited to 'internal/postgres/unit.go')
-rw-r--r--internal/postgres/unit.go16
1 files changed, 4 insertions, 12 deletions
diff --git a/internal/postgres/unit.go b/internal/postgres/unit.go
index 59871efd..2e16b7af 100644
--- a/internal/postgres/unit.go
+++ b/internal/postgres/unit.go
@@ -104,13 +104,7 @@ func (db *DB) GetUnit(ctx context.Context, um *internal.UnitMeta, fields interna
if err != nil && !errors.Is(err, derrors.NotFound) {
return nil, err
}
- if doc != nil {
- u.Package = &internal.Package{
- Path: u.Path,
- Name: u.Name,
- Documentation: doc,
- }
- }
+ u.Documentation = doc
}
if fields&internal.WithImports != 0 {
imports, err := db.getImports(ctx, pathID)
@@ -130,12 +124,10 @@ func (db *DB) GetUnit(ctx context.Context, um *internal.UnitMeta, fields interna
}
if fields == internal.AllFields {
if u.Name != "" {
- if u.Package == nil {
- u.Package = &internal.Package{
- Path: u.Path,
- }
+ u.Package = &internal.Package{
+ Path: u.Path,
+ Name: u.Name,
}
- u.Package.Name = u.Name
}
}
if !db.bypassLicenseCheck {